The Role
You'll be joining a small, highly skilled team responsible for the design, development, and support of complex electronic devices that power advanced systems used globally. Working across the full product lifecycle, you'll have the chance to get hands-on with everything from schematic capture and PCB layout to firmware and FPGA design.
Key Responsibilities:
Design and development of analogue and digital hardware.
Schematic capture and multi-layer PCB design.
Test, debug, and fault-finding of electronic systems.
Contribution to firmware and FPGA design.
Supporting products through their lifecycle, including upgrades and obsolescence management.
Developing test processes and equipment.
About You
We're looking for someone with a strong technical foundation and a genuine curiosity to keep learning. Training and support will be provided to help fill in any gaps, but you should bring:
Essential:
Degree in Electronic Engineering (2:1 or above) or equivalent.
Strong electronic design skills.
Excellent communication and teamwork abilities.
A proactive, self-motivated approach.
Desirable (but not essential):
Master's degree in Electronic Engineering or related field.
Experience in FPGA design (VHDL, Intel Quartus Prime).
PCB design experience (Altium Designer).
Knowledge of communication interfaces (Ethernet, RS232, RS485, SPI, I2C).
Embedded software experience in C/C++.
Familiarity with transitioning designs into production.
